<p>A process for the manufacture of porous clay building materials using finely comminuted biomass such as bark, wood waste or domestic garbage as a material which undergoes gasification during the firing process and leaves pores in the fired clay, comprising the following process steps: a) the biomass is coked after separating out any iron and, if necessary, coarse pre-comminution or homogenisation, b) the low temperature coke is comminuted to an edge length of around, or less than, 4 mm, mixed with moist clay (loam or lean (?)) clay), and the mixture shaped into the desired articles, c) the articles are dried and fired in the conventional manner, with the low temperature carbonization gas from the initial coking being used as additional fuel for the firing furnace, and d) the waste gas (flue gas) from the furnace is used for coking the biomass. s</p> |
